Nikon has released the latest iteration of its workhorse 70-200mm F2.8 lens. The AF-S Nikkor 70-200mm F2.8E FL ED VR, as it is known, has a new optical design, improved Vibration Reduction as well as an electromagnetic diaphragm.

Tamron makes a 70-200 f2.8, model number a001. It goes for about $770 new. You can pick it up for around $570 or so used on KEH. The lens is pretty good optically but it's not a really high performer when it comes to autofocus speed. The Nikon 80-200mm f2.8D ED AF is a superb 2.5x telephoto zoom for sports, portraits, and nature photography. With a fast and constant f2.8 maximum aperture through the entire focal range, ED glass elements provide high-resolution and high-contrast image even at maximum aperture. The rotating zoom ring provides precise zoom operation.
